Aluminum panels dent differently than steel, but our technicians are prepared to tackle all types of dents on your car’s body. For small dings or hail damage where the paint isn’t cracked, we often use paintless dent repair (PDR) techniques. Our team is trained to perform PDR on aluminum, carefully massaging out dents from behind the panel. (Aluminium doesn’t “remember” its shape like steel, so PDR on aluminum requires more time and skill — but we have the expertise to do it.)
If a dent is too sharp, large, or the paint is damaged, we use conventional repair methods. This can include gently pulling or hammering the dented section back to shape, then applying minimal filler if needed. We then prime and repaint the area to blend with the surrounding panel. Our goal is to remove any trace of the dent while preserving as much of the original panel as possible. After our dent repair, your aluminum body panels will be smooth and the damage will be virtually invisible, with no mismatched paint or uneven surfaces.
In cases of severe damage or crumpled aluminum sections, a panel replacement might be the safest and most effective solution. Swedish Experts can replace entire body panels (such as doors, fenders, bonnet/hood, trunk lid, or quarter panels) on aluminum-bodied cars. We source genuine or OEM aluminum replacement panels to ensure perfect fit and compatibility with your vehicle.
Our workshop is fully equipped for aluminum panel installation. We follow manufacturer-recommended procedures for removing the damaged section and installing the new panel. This often involves specialized riveting and bonding techniques (since aluminum is often riveted and adhesively bonded instead of traditionally welded). Where welding is required (for example, on certain structural parts), we use aluminum-specific welding equipment and methods to protect the metal’s integrity.
During replacement, we take care to align the new panel precisely so that all gaps and seams match factory specifications. After securing the panel, we finish by painting it to match the rest of the car. The result: your vehicle’s body is restored to its original shape, strength, and appearance. Panel replacements are done in a controlled environment to avoid any galvanic corrosion (no steel particles come into contact with your aluminum). When we’re finished, it will look like the damage never happened at all.
Whether your aluminum-bodied car needs a touch-up after repairs or a refinish due to paint damage, our professional painting services have you covered. Aluminum requires proper surface preparation and primers for paint to adhere correctly – and we strictly follow these requirements.
For any repair that requires repainting, we start by preparing the aluminum surface: cleaning thoroughly, removing any oxidation, and applying an etching or epoxy primer made for aluminum. This process ensures long-lasting paint adhesion and prevents issues like peeling or corrosion later on. We then mix high-quality paint to exactly match your vehicle’s factory color code. Our painters blend the new paint into adjacent panels for a seamless transition, so you won’t be able to tell where the old paint ends and the new paint begins.
We perform the repaint in a controlled spray booth, maintaining optimal conditions for a smooth, dust-free finish. After painting, a clear coat is applied and cured to protect the paint and give it a consistent shine. Finally, we polish the area so that the repaired section matches the gloss and texture of the rest of your car. Our repainting process for aluminum bodies leaves your vehicle looking as good as new, with a durable finish that withstands the elements.

Yes, in many cases we can. Paintless dent repair (PDR) is possible on aluminum panels for certain types of dents – typically smaller, shallow dents where the paint is intact. However, aluminum is harder to work with than steel, so PDR on aluminum might take more time or be a bit more challenging. Our PDR specialists have the experience to perform dent removals on aluminum when feasible, using special techniques and patience. If a dent is too severe for PDR, we’ll let you know and can perform a conventional repair instead. Either way, we will choose the method that best restores your panel without unnecessary repainting if possible.
